Ingredients
Scale
- 105 g (3.7 oz) almond flour, sifted
- 105 g (3.7 oz) confectioners sugar, sifted
- 100 g (3.5 oz) white sugar
- 100 g (3.5 oz) egg whites
- 3 g (1 tsp) egg white powder (optional but highly recommended)
- 1 tsp artificial vanilla
- Nonpareils rainbow sprinkles
- 1 cup (227 g / 8 oz) unsalted butter, room temperature
- 1 cup (130 g / 4.6 oz) white or yellow boxed cake mix
- 3 cups (360 g / 12.7 oz) confectioners sugar
- 2 tbsps (28 g / 1 oz) heavy cream
- 1 tsp artificial vanilla
- Pink food coloring
Instructions
- Preparation: Line two baking sheets with parchment or silicone mats, ensuring smooth surfaces for precise macaron creation.
- Dry Ingredient Fusion: Sift almond flour and confectioners sugar together, whisking until completely integrated and lump-free.
- Meringue Foundation: Combine egg whites, white sugar, and egg white powder in a stand mixer bowl, positioning over simmering water while continuously whisking until mixture reaches 140°F, developing a glossy, stable base.
- Meringue Transformation: Remove from heat and beat at low speed, progressively accelerating to high until stiff, voluminous peaks materialize. Briefly incorporate vanilla extract while maintaining meringue structure.
- Batter Development: Gently sift dry ingredients into the meringue, using a delicate folding technique to preserve air bubbles. Continue folding until the batter achieves a lava-like consistency capable of forming seamless figure-8 shapes.
- Piping and Decoration: Transfer mixture to a piping bag with a round tip, carefully creating uniform 1½-inch diameter circles on prepared sheets. Firmly tap baking sheets against the counter to eliminate air pockets and sprinkle rainbow sprinkles across surfaces.
- Resting and Skin Formation: Allow macarons to rest in a humidity-controlled environment for 30-60 minutes, developing a protective skin.
- Baking Process: Preheat oven to 300°F (or 275°F for convection), baking macarons until they develop a delicate, crisp exterior with characteristic “feet” formation, approximately 15-20 minutes.
- Buttercream Preparation: Microwave boxed cake mix in short intervals, stirring to prevent scorching. Whip butter until exceptionally fluffy, gradually incorporating cooled cake mix and confectioners sugar.
- Flavor Enhancement: Enrich buttercream with heavy cream, vanilla extract, and food coloring for vibrant birthday cake essence.
- Assembly and Finishing: Pipe buttercream between matching macaron halves, creating delectable sandwich cookies. Refrigerate overnight to allow flavors to meld and develop optimal taste and consistency.
Notes
- Humidity Matters: Control room moisture to prevent macaron cracking and ensure smooth, glossy shells.
- Precise Temperature Control: Use a digital thermometer when heating egg whites to achieve perfect meringue stability.
- Gentle Folding Technique: Mix batter with minimal strokes to maintain delicate air bubbles and achieve ideal macaron texture.
- Resting Time is Crucial: Allow macarons to form a protective skin before baking, which helps create signature crisp exterior and smooth feet.
